Day 1

Arrival in Arusha City

Arrival in Arusha City

Welcome to Tanzania! Upon arrival at Kilimanjaro International Airport (JRO), you’ll be warmly welcomed by your safari representative and transferred to your accommodation in Arusha. The drive takes around 45 minutes to 1 hour, depending on traffic. If you arrive at Arusha Airport (ARK), the transfer to Arusha takes around 20–30 minutes.

Once you arrive, take some time to settle in and relax after your journey. Optional for an extra cost: a guided Arusha city tour can be arranged, giving you the opportunity to experience local markets, culture and some of the city’s highlights. In the evening, enjoy dinner and a peaceful overnight stay as you prepare for your safari adventure.

Day 2

Arusha to Tarangire

Arusha to Tarangire

Start your morning with an early breakfast before leaving Arusha for Tarangire National Park, a drive of around 2.5 hours. Along the way, enjoy views of the Tanzanian countryside as you pass local villages, farmlands and changing landscapes before reaching the park.

Once inside Tarangire, enjoy a full-day game drive through its scenic savannah, known for its ancient baobabs and large elephant herds. You may also spot giraffes, zebras, wildebeest, buffalo, impalas and a variety of birdlife. Stop at a designated picnic area for lunch before continuing your game drive into the afternoon. Later, leave the park and drive to your accommodation in Karatu for dinner and a relaxing evening.

Day 3

Karatu to Southern Serengeti (Ndutu)

Karatu to Southern Serengeti (Ndutu)

After an early breakfast, leave Karatu and travel towards Southern Serengeti and the Ndutu plains, passing through the scenic landscapes of the Ngorongoro Conservation Area. As the highlands give way to open grasslands and acacia-dotted plains, you’ll enter the Ndutu area.

During the calving season, thousands of wildebeest and zebras gather here, with newborn calves across the plains and predators nearby. Enjoy a game drive through the open plains and woodland, keeping an eye out for lions, cheetahs, hyenas, elephants, giraffes and other wildlife. Stop at a designated picnic area for lunch before continuing your game drive into the afternoon. Later, arrive at your accommodation in Ndutu for dinner and a relaxing evening.

Day 4

Game Drive at Southern Serengeti & Ndutu Plains

Game Drive at Southern Serengeti & Ndutu Plains

After breakfast, head out for a full-day game drive across the Ndutu plains in Southern Serengeti. During the calving season, thousands of wildebeest and zebras gather in the area, with newborn calves attracting predators such as lions, cheetahs and hyenas. Your guide will follow the wildlife activity and choose the best areas to explore, giving you the chance to observe the migration and the natural events that come with it.

Enjoy a picnic lunch at a designated area before continuing your game drive through the afternoon. Along the way, look out for elephants, giraffes, gazelles, buffalo and a variety of birdlife. Later, return to your accommodation for dinner and a relaxing evening after another day exploring Ndutu.

Day 6

Guided Game Ngorongoro Crater & Departure

Guided Game Ngorongoro Crater & Departure

After an early breakfast, descend into the Ngorongoro Crater for your final safari experience. Enjoy a game drive across the crater floor, where you may see lions, elephants, buffalo, zebras, wildebeest, hippos and, with some luck, the endangered black rhino. Stop at a designated picnic area for lunch before continuing your exploration of the crater.

After the game drive, ascend from the crater and continue towards Arusha or the airport for your departure. As your safari comes to an end, take with you wonderful memories of Tarangire, the Ndutu migration experience and the Ngorongoro Crater.
